Canon PIXMA MP150 Spec Sheet


The PIXMA MP150 is a modestly priced multifunction printer that can print a borderless 4" x 6" inch photo in approximately 55 seconds, according to Canon.

The PIXMA MP150 has a rectangular shape with a matte gray finish. It features Canon's patented FINE technology meaning that it has a multinozzle print head. The PIXMA MP150 has 1,472 nozzles and a color resolution of up 4800 x 1200 dots per inch (dpi). It has a black and white resolution of up to 600 x 600 dpi.

For scanning, it features a lid which enables to user to scan bulky items such as a personal notebook. It has a scanning resolution of 1200 x 2400 dpi (optical) and 19,200 x 19,200 dpi (interpolated). It can copy black and white documents at a rate of about 2.7 seconds per page and color documents at a rate of about 3.5 seconds per page, according to Canon.

For users with a PictBridge ready digital camera or DV camcorder, you can plug in your device and print photos directly without the need for a computer. Photos printed on the PIXMA MP150 on select Canon paper can last up to 100 years when stored properly, according to Canon.
